Born in Milford on January 18, 1968 to the late Charles E. Dallachie and Margaret M. Dallachie née Bane. Passed away on September 29, 2019 at the VA hospital in West Haven, CT. after a long battle with neuroendocrine cancer.

Matt is survived by his wife, Linda (Reineke) and three children; two daughters, Terryn (29) and her husband Michael Bolton Jr. of Norfolk VA, Jordan (25) of West Haven CT, and her boyfriend, Nick Capozzo, and one son, Brendan (22), of West Haven CT. He is also survived by one granddaughter, Raelynn Nicole Bolton (2).

Matt attended St. Mary’s Catholic School then went on to graduate from Foran High School, both in Milford. He became an EMT in 1992 and joined the Navy Reserve in 1996. After four years he went over to the Air Force Reserves who helped him to obtain his goal of getting a degree in nursing. He graduated second in his class in 2001. After 9/11 he was called to active duty serving almost 8 years total. He retired from the reserves with full honors after 21 years of service. In civilian life he worked at Bridgeport Hospital for 14 years. Mostly in the emergency department & later on the surgical & orthopedic recovery floor. He also volunteered with the town of Stratford as an EMT for a few years during the mid 90’s. Aside from dedicating his life to helping others Matt had other passions as well. He had a great love of animals, especially dogs & helped in the fight against puppy mills & pet shops who did business with them. He loved cooking & fishing, firearms & arguing politics on Facebook. Most of all he and an amazing sense of humor. There will be a little less laughter in the world without him in it.
